Context on celebrity status reporting and death hoaxes

Why misinformation spreads quickly

Celebrity death hoaxes propagate rapidly because they generate strong emotional reactions and clicks. Factors that contribute include confirmation bias, where users share claims that align with existing beliefs; algorithmic rewards for engagement; and the speed of social platforms relative to fact-checking. High-profile figures like Diane Keaton are frequent targets, making critical evaluation essential.
